DC Universe’s first live-action drama series Titans will release to the home entertainment market on July 16.

Titans follow a group of young superheroes from across the DC pantheon as they face the trials of teendom in this gritty take on the Teen Titans franchise.  Even before it premiered last October, the show had been renewed for a second season (see “Kaley Cuoco Voices 'Harley Quinn,' 'Doom Patrol' Adds Matt Bomer, 'Titans' Go! for Second Season”). The first season covers the backstories of each of the main characters (Robin, Starfire, Raven, and Beast Boy).

Titans: The Complete First Season will release on Blu-ray ($29.98) and DVD ($24.98) and also be available as a digital download. It will include the 11 episodes, plus these special features:
